Eugene "Gene" Gray, 81, passed away Nov. 19, 2018, at home with his family by his side after several years of declining health. He was born May 16, 1937, in Central Falls, R.I., to Harold and Anita (Levesque) Gray.

He moved to Kearsarge, N.H., at age 5, graduated from Kennett High School in 1956 and joined the Air Force after graduation.

He married Charlyne Russell in 1958, and they celebrated their 60th anniversary in September 2018.

After returning to Conway in 1960 he worked several jobs: Abbott's Dairy, Eastern Slope Auto Body, Kearsarge Metallurgical, G.B. Carrier Corp. and the Town of Conway from which he retired in 1998.

He was a past member of the Conway Elks Club, Elmwood Grange, Conway Fire Department, North Conway Country Club and the American Legion.

He loved hunting, fishing and golf.

He is survived by his wife Charlyne (Russel) Gray; a daughter, two sons. He was predeceased by his parents; his sister Shirley Lowell; and his brother Robert Gray.

Interment in the Conway Village Cemetery later in the spring.

Conway Daily Sun, December 3, 2018
